上一章讲述了Springboot+Idea+JDK8配置一个简单的Swagger访问页面,接下来,详细解释一下Swagger中配置的常用的api注解 功能@Api 作用于类,描述类,不用不扫描@ApiOperation 作用于方法,描述方法@ApiParam 作用于参数,描述参数@ApiImplicitParam 和 @ApiImpl…
上一章讲述了Springboot+Idea+JDK8配置一个简单的Swagger访问页面,接下来,详细解释一下Swagger中配置的常用的api注解 功能@Api 作用于类,描述类,不用不扫描@ApiOperation 作用于方法,描述方法@ApiParam 作用于参数,描述参数@ApiImplicitParam 和 @ApiImpl…
什么是Swagger??? 自己百度官方定义,我目前使用到的,通过类似于注释的配置注解,自动生成一个整齐的页面展示,方便对接前端,同时可以页面测试的巨方便的一个好东西.使用方法 1、配置pom文件 <!-- swagger --> <dependency> …
Swagger 是一个规范和完整的框架,用于生成、描述、调用和可视化 RESTful 风格的 Web 服务。总体目标是使客户端和文件系统作为服务器以同样的速度来更新。文件的方法,参数和模型紧密集成到服务器端的代码,允许API来始终保持同步。作用: 接口的文档在线自动生成。 功能…
目录1、错误情况展示2、正确图3、更换swagger版本为2.5即可问题描述:点不开api详情,就无法进行测试接口。网上很多说是中文原因。其实是版本问题1、错误情况展示2、正确图3、更换swagger版本为2.5即可 <dependency> <groupId>io.springfox&…
背景最近往自己的框架里集成swagger,发现一个奇怪的问题,当我的tag是中文的时候。发现点击展开不生效,只能点击全部展开,这就十分不方便了。如下图只能点击expand operations。解决方案第一种方案:如果说我们将tags改为英文,那么发现界面展开好使。第二种方案:如果…
文章目录 1、maven依赖 1、swagger2 注解整体说明 2、@Api:请求类的说明 3、@ApiOperation:方法的说明 3.1、@ApiImplicitParams、@ApiImplicitParam:方法参数的说明 4、@ApiResponses、@ApiResponse:方法返回值的状态码说明 5、@ApiModel:用于…
实际项目中非常需要写文档,提高Java服务端和Web前端以及移动端的对接效率。 听说Swagger这个工具,还不错,就网上找了些资料,自己实践了下。 一:Swagger介绍Swagger是当前最好用的Restful API文档生成的开源项目,通过swagger-spring项目实现了与SpingMVC框架的无缝集…
一、简介Swagger 是一个规范和完整的框架,用于生成、描述、调用和可视化 RESTful 风格的 Web 服务。总体目标是使客户端和文件系统作为服务器以同样的速度来更新 。接口的方法,参数和模型紧密集成到服务器端的代码,允许API来始终保持同步。Swagger 让部署管理和使用功能…
API管理系统介绍 前后端都分离了,该搞个好用的API管理系统了! 参考文献:https://mp.weixin.qq.com/s/Ahs6fnIfFVVPOn3NZpIsNASwagger: https://swagger.io/YApi:http://yapi.demo.qunar.com/eolinker:https://www.eolinker.com/易文档:https://easydoc.xyz/S…
背景介绍:刚开始的时候,在controller层使用@RequestParam的时候,发现这个参数是必须要输入值的,但是我们有时候必须查询的时候允许参数为空,使用这个注解就不行了。在集成了swagger2后,找了半天的原因,发现使用@ApiImplicitParam这个注解可以解决这个问题。对应下面…
© Copyright 2014 - 2024 柏港建站平台 ejk5.com. 渝ICP备16000791号-4